Vendor contracts with Oakspire Learning expire in March and should be renegotiated before renewal. Quarterly reporting templates are in the shared planning folder. Devi will confirm final allocations after the January review. The rationale tied to our wider plans is set out in the confidential note below.

internal memo for kawip-hadug: Headcount on the Wenwyn team goes from 7 to 140 by the end of January. Gross margin on Wenwyn came in at 20 percent against a plan of 15 percent.

Team,

Welcome. Quick context before I'm out: the Tollgate payments service integration suite has been flaky for two weeks. Failures cluster around the refund-idempotency tests. Root cause is almost certainly the shared test database getting truncated mid-run by a parallel CI job — Marek filed a ticket to isolate schemas per runner.

Until that lands, rerun failures once before investigating. Don't mute the suite; it still catches real regressions.

The shared test database is reachable via the connection string below.

— Ines

primary connection of yagep-kahip = redis://giliel_svc:zYiKsLL2PLpfPL@db-348f.xolmarsys.corp:5432/fenwyn

// ORDERS_SOFT_DELETE_RETENTION_DAYS
// Orders in the Peltwick database are never hard-deleted; rows are
// flagged and purged by a sweeper after this many days. Queries must
// always filter on the deleted_at column. Soft-delete behavior was
// introduced in the build noted below.

trace token, kahog-tajeg: htk6_97d963

Subject: Hardware lab access — contractors

All visiting contractors: the hardware lab (Level 2, east corridor) is escort-only before 09:00. Sign in at the front desk, collect a visitor lanyard, and wait for your Veltrix host. Tools must be logged in and out. No photos inside the lab. If your host is delayed more than ten minutes, use the temporary door code below to wait in the anteroom only.

door code, yagap-bahof: bdg-O-05